It all starts at Sunset

Your journey begins on a lone sand dune. A path takes you to an uninterrupted, three hundred and sixty-degree view of this vast landscape. In front of you is the fabled Uluru; behind you are the domes of Kata Tjuta and, possibly the most spectacular sunset and evening sky you have ever seen. Sunrise At The Rock

We depart before sunrise for Ayer's Rock, Uluru to the Aboriginal people. Enjoy an impressive display of color as the sun rises. It's a brisk morning, but well worth it to experience Ayer's Rock up close with its own brilliant display of colors. Enjoy a continental br...
